They involve the ideas of the various individuals for whom designed, as well as the requirements of location and site for which intended. Some of them have already been built; some are now in course of erection: while others are being perfected as regards their details, preparatory to construction. They have been gathered in this form by the Author in order to give a Collection of Designs for Villas and Cottages, varying somewhat from the great portion of such buildings now being erected in various parts of the country; and as an expression of ideas from which yersons intending to build may form their model before having working plans pre dared. ] fo) fo) 5 We MEOW Albany.
